How much does it cost to start a Ford franchise?

Ford Motor Group The initial franchise fee is around $30,000. But this doesn't include the money for building space, inventory, and other equipment costs. With all the additional requirements, it becomes over $150K to be a franchisee.

Are car dealerships profitable?

Used car dealerships are profitable. Selling used cars is more profitable than selling new cars. According to the National Car Dealerships Association, the average gross profit on a used car is $2,000 while the average gross profit on a new car is $1,200.

Who owns Ford currently?

William Clay Ford Jr. As executive chair of Ford Motor Company, William Clay Ford Jr. is leading the company that put the world on wheels into the 21st century. He joined the board of directors in 1988 and has been its chair since January 1999.

Who owns Ford own?

Ford Motor Company is not owned by another corporation; instead, it is only owned by shareholders. Since the shareholders are collectively the owners of the company, those with more shares technically own more of Ford Motor Co.

What is the most profitable department in a car dealership?

service and parts DepartmentUsing data from the publicly traded dealership groups, Forbes' Jim Henry has discovered that the most profitable part of a dealer's business is its service and parts Department.

How Much Does it Cost to Start a Car Dealership In 2022?

The average startup cost of a car dealership ranges from $100,000 to $300,000 but could go up to close to $12M especially for a new car dealership for popular brands. The biggest contributor to this is the initial car franchise dealership fee, which could range from $30,000 to $500,000, and whether or not you need to acquire land and construct a showroom.

How to become a Ford dealer?

Once you’re ready to get started, contact Ford and ask for an application to become a dealer. Once approved as a franchisee, you’ll be asked to sign legal documentation agreeing to Ford’s terms. Among other things, this agreement outlines Ford’s right to terminate its relationship with you at any time should your dealership prove unsatisfactory. This means that you must ensure strong sales and a commitment to a positive customer experience, among other obligations. Although it will require a small investment on your part, a quick review from an attorney can save you headaches down the line.

What is Ford dealership culture?

Once you’ve signed on to be a Ford dealer , you’ll be part of the overall Ford culture. The company has recently stressed the importance of its dealerships in sharing its long-term vision. This includes crowdsourced shuttle services, ridesharing, drones and autonomous vehicles as part of its City of Tomorrow proposal. Successful dealerships will pay close attention to this vision and get involved in making it happen in their own communities.

How long does it take to own a Hyundai dealership?

in 1986. Contrary to the other companies, Hyundai requires you to own a dealership for two years before partnering or franchising. To invest in the business is expensive, costing over $500K. However, with the requirement that you must own a dealership first, there is a better chance you will already have the money needed.
